Crooked Timber pointed me to a poll on Norman Geras’s weblog: what are your top 10 all-time favorite films? Here’s what I submitted (accents and formatting modified from the original, otherwise unchanged):

  • Amélie (Jeunet)
  • Citizen Kane (Welles) (It may be clichéd to put this in a best-of list, but it really is one of my favorites. The DVD edition with Roger Ebert’s commentary is particularly illuminating.)
  • Dr. Strangelove (Kubrick)
  • Manhattan (Woody Allen)
  • Man Without A Past, The” (Kaurismaki)
  • Network (Lumet)
  • North By Northwest (Hitchcock)
  • Rear Window (Hitchcock)
  • Talk To Her (Almodóvar)
